Our unique Allons environment brings specific considerations. The humid summers and occasionally chilly winters mean a good boarding facility should have solid climate control—not just a fan in July or a simple heater in January. Ask potential sitters about their protocols for temperature regulation and if pets get access to shaded, outdoor play areas during milder weather. Given our beautiful, rural setting, it's also wise to inquire about flea, tick, and mosquito prevention measures, especially if your pet will be enjoying any outdoor time.

Once you have a few names, schedule a visit. A reputable provider will welcome you to tour their space. Look for cleanliness, secure fencing, and, most importantly, staff who engage with the animals calmly and kindly.
To ensure your pet's stay is as smooth as possible, pack a piece of home. This includes their regular food (to avoid stomach upset), a familiar blanket or bed, and a favorite toy. Don't forget to provide detailed care instructions and your vet's contact information. A little preparation goes a long way in easing your pet's anxiety—and yours!
